THE fight for equality has entered the hairdresser's, with a leading salon group making men's and women's haircuts the same price.

Toni & Guy salons have done away with pricing on a gender basis and introduced a flat fee for basic styling services. Men and women pay $72 for a stylist cut and blow dry and $89 for an art director cut and blow dry.

The move follows a Victorian case lodged against Melbourne hairdresser Edward Beale.

In August, 2000, travel consultant Amanda Atkins claimed she was charged $56 for a haircut while men were charged $38 for a similar cut. Mr Beale was forced to remove references to women's and men's prices.
